Company activities and impact

G.B. Racketlon Association CIC facilitates the sport of Racketlon in the UK, promoting an accessible, healthy sporting activity to all genders, ages and abilities. This is primarily represented by the UK Tour, which featured in this period 14 tournaments including a Counties based team event, and 291 unique players. The World Championships were in August 2025, where Great Britain were very successful, taking a record high number of teams. Regular newsletters were sent, and promotion of the sport on Facebook, Instagram and Twitter, where a new website was launched. Greater use of Whatsapp groups were initiated during this period.

Consultation with stakeholders

As governing body, the objective of the GBRA is to promote Racketlon in the United Kingdom, making Racketlon and multi-racket sports (table tennis, badminton, squash and tennis as one concept) accessible to as many groups and individuals as possible, excluding no one. Racketlon is fun, clean and healthy. England has excellent facilities for people of all ages and abilities to enjoy Racketlon and the GBRA is committed to facilitate and encourage that enjoyment. The AGM was held within the period on Sunday 8th December 2024, providing updates on activity of the board and the UK tour.
